One of the better and authentic Chinese HK restaurants in the area. Their dimsum was much better when they first opened, but the quality is still outstanding. Everything price-wise has gone up. But HL does a good job in maintaining its quality. Both lunch and dinner was fantastic and the ingredients were quite fresh. A little tip for dimsum newbies- you want to go when there is a lot of people, so the cooks keep making the dimsum items fresh. When dimsum gets cold- it's quality and taste sharply diminishes... Anyways, parking is generally okay- and it can get kind of packed here. But there is a lot of space- and also a Costco Business nearby if you need to do some shopping afterwards. The atmosphere is nice- usually a little loud with the conversations and all that's happening- but that is to be expected. I was here recently for a large family lunch meal celebration, and the seafood was 10/10! Crab, lobster, seabass- amazing. The quail was solid too, but it was the seafood that blew me away. You have to try it. I actually think their dishes are superior than their dimsum, which is saying something! Okay, enjoy and hope the photos do the dishes justice.
